Sunteți pe pagina 1din 10

Universitatea “DUNĂREA DE JOS” Galaţi

Facultatea de Automatică, Calculatoare, Inginerie Electrica şi Electronică,


Specializarea Calculatoare

Managementul Proiectelor Informatice


Gestiunea online a unei agenţii de transport
feroviar

Profesor Coordonator: Student:


Prof. Dr. Ing. Luminiţa DUMITRIU Catrinoiu George Bogdan

1
Cuprins
Introducere.......................................................................................................................................................3
I. Planificarea proiectului..........................................................................................................................4
1. Discuţia cu beneficiarul........................................................................................................................4
2. Scopul proiectului.................................................................................................................................4
3. Obiectivele proiectului..........................................................................................................................4
4. Beneficiarul şi finanţatorul proiectului.................................................................................................4
5. Executant..............................................................................................................................................4
6. Dunara proiectului................................................................................................................................5
II. Stabilirea resurselor şi alocarea lor.......................................................................................................5
1. Resurse umane......................................................................................................................................5
III. Execuţia activităţilor..........................................................................................................................6
1. Estimarea efortului pe fiecare activitate................................................................................................6
2. Calendarul de execuţie..........................................................................................................................6
IV. Managementul comunicării cu clientul.............................................................................................7
V. Managementul riscurilor.......................................................................................................................7
1. Identificarea riscurilor:.........................................................................................................................7
VI. Managementul resurselor..................................................................................................................7
VII. Managementul activităţilor................................................................................................................8
1. Activităţile necesare dezvoltării proiectului..........................................................................................8
VIII. Managementul calităţii.......................................................................................................................9
IX. Încheierea proiectului.........................................................................................................................9
Bibliografie.....................................................................................................................................................10

2
Introducere

Managementul proiectelor este o ramura specializata a managementului aparuta in 1950


pentru coordonarea si controlul activitatilor complexe din industria moderna. Aceasta ramura s-a
dezvoltat cu repeziciune mai ales dupa anii ’90 remarcandu-se o crestere a eforturilor de definire a
sistemului teoretic al managementului proiectelor si de a-l exprima sub forma de carti, ghiduri, studii
si standarde.
Pe masura ce mediul de afaceri a devenit din ce in ce mai complex, atat pe plan mondial cat
si in tara noastra, folosirea echipelor de lucru interdisciplinare a devenit o necessitate, ce a schimbat
radical mediul de munca. Aceste schimbari au alimentat nevoia de proiecte complexe, aparand astfel
necesitatea unui management de proiecte mai sofisticat si mai cuprinzator. Pentru a avea mai multe
avantaje competitive si pentru a genera raspunsurile competitive corespunzatoare, o organizatie
trebuie sa cunoasca si sa foloseasca tehnicile modern ale managementului de proiect.
Managementul proiectelor este o strategie managerial aplicata mai ales in informatizari si
investitii de alta natura. Ea presupune constituirea unei echipe de specialist in analiza, proiectarea si
implementarea de aplicatii informatice si implicarea de specialisti din diferite departamente
functionale: contabilitate, commercial si managementul resurselor umane. Echipele de proiect au ca
obiectiv lansarea si realizarea proiectului cu respectarea specificatiilor tehnice, a termenelor de
executie si a bugetului de cheltuieli.
Odata cu evolutia tehnologiei tot mai multe companii din diferite domenii au inceput sa
foloseasca instrumente software in dezvoltarea si administrarea proiectelor. Microsoft Project este de
departe cel mai utilizat program de managementul proiectului, in special pentru a define scopul,
timpul, costurile si resursele umane necesare unui proiect.

3
I. Planificarea proiectului
1. Discuţia cu beneficiarul
Aceasta discutie este utila pentru a putea stabili atat scopul proiectului, cat si urmatoarele
activitati care vor fi desfasurate in cadrul proiectului. Project Manager-ul, in intalnirea cu
beneficiarul, are rolul de a fla cat mai multe detalii cu privire la produsul care urmeaza a fi dezvoltat,
de a-i explica beneficiarului ce este mai util si mai optim pentru nevoile sale, in cazul in care acesta
nu are suficiente informatii. In urma acestei discutii, Project Manager-ul va cunoaste dorintele si
asteptarile beneficiarului si se iau in calcul eventualele constrangeri care apar datorita complexitatii
softului.
In functie de complexitatea produsului se va estima timpul necesar dezvoltarii acestuia,
precum si costul acestuia. Project Manager-ul si beneficiarul stabilesc de comun acord sa pastreze o
colaborare pe toata durata proiectului prin diferite mijloace de comunicare( mail, telefon etc.).

2. Scopul proiectului
In acest proiect, compania “Smart Solution”, in calitatea sa de executant are drept principal
obiectiv realizarea unui site, reprezentand scopul activitatii societatii "S.C. Transferoviar S.R.L.",
prin care sa ofere clientilor informatii legate de trenuri, trasee, orare, abonamente si oferte.
Mai mult, prin intermediul site-ului pot fi realizate actualizari asupra preturilor, plecarilor si
sosirilor trenurilor si disponibilitatea locurilor.

3. Obiectivele proiectului
Obiectivul principal al acestui proiect este sa cream un site capabil sa indeplineasca aceste
functii:
 sa prezinte si sa promoveze societatea comerciala " S.C. Transferoviar S.R.L."
 sa permita adaugarea de noutati si promotii, prin care sa promoveze ofertele si serviciile
 sa permita utilizatorilor sa interactioneze cu personalul magazinului in scopul informarii
 sa ofere posibilitatea gasirii statiei dorite
 sa ofere o sectiune legata de intrebarile frecvente ale clientilor si raspunsul la acestea
 sa permita alegerea limbii dorite( romana sau engleza)

4. Beneficiarul şi finanţatorul proiectului


S.C. TRANSFEROVIAR S.R.L. este un operator feroviar cu capital privat având ca obiect
principal de activitate efectuarea transportului feroviar public de călători în trafic intern și
internațional. T.F.C. asigura transportul de călători atât pe 5 secții neinteroperabile (Galati – Barlad,
Buzau – Nehoiasu, Slanic – Ploiesti Sud, Titan Sud – Oltenita) cât și pe infrastructura interoperabilă
in zona regionalei Cluj si Bucuresti.
OBIECTIVE:
 Cresterea vitezei de circulatie si diminuarea timpilor de parcurs pe sectiile neinteroperabile;
 Cresterea anuala cu 10 – 15% a numarului de calatori;
 Scaderea cu 15 – 20% a numarului de reclamatii din partea calatorilor;
 Diversificarea canalelor de promovare.

5. Executant
5.1. Smart Solution
Detaliile companiei:
 Nume companie: S.C. Smart Solution S.R.L.
 Adresa: Str. Libertaţii, Nr. 1, CP 900568, Galaţi, România
 Telefon: 0748438019
 Fax: 0236 823 328

4
 E-mail: office@smartsolution.com
 Web: www.smartsolution.ro

5.2. Experienţă şi portofoliu


Cu o experienţă de 8 ani, compania noastra se poate laudă cu un portofoliu impresionant.
Împreuna am fost implicaţi în multe proiecte importante dintre care putem enumera mai multe
asociaţii multinaţionale precum Oracle şi Yahoo.
Am elaborat proiecte pentru:
 Librării şi magazine de antichitaţi: produse software de management al documentelor, dar şi
aplicaţii web pentru promovare.
 Universitaţi şi licee: managementul studenţilor/elevilor şi a profesorilor, site-uri web si
promovare.

6. Dunara proiectului
Durata estimată pentru durata acestui proiect este de 2 luni şi jumătate, cca. 56 de zile
lucrătoare. În acest interval de timp sunt incluse toate etapele necesare implementării şi finalizării cu
success a proiectului.
Data de început: 2.03.2015
Data finalizării: 25.05.2015

II. Stabilirea resurselor şi alocarea lor


Pentru dezvoltarea unui astfel de proiect trebuie avute în vedere atât costurile pentru
implementarea şi derularea proiectului cât şi costurile generale de administraţie (salarii, energie, apă,
etc.)

1. Resurse umane
Resursă umana este cel mai important factor pentru a putea fi implementat cu success un
proiect, indifferent de amploarea sa. Ţinând cont de acest factor, pentru realizarea proiectului de faţă
este necesară formarea unei echipe alcătuită din:
 Manager de proiect – este implicat in coordonarea activitatilor intre departamente, dar si in
discutia cu beneficiarul
 Analist – studiaza problema si gaseste solutii, ofera o lista de date ce trebuie introduse si ce
operatii sunt efectuate asupra acelor date .
 Proiectant baze de date – proiecteaza baza de date
 2 Programatori juniori – implementeaza interfata cu utilizatorul, introduc datele in baza de date,
implementeaza anumite restrictii in ceea ce priveste datele ce vor fi introduse in baza de date
 2 Programatori seniori – creeaza legatura cu baza de date si asigura functionalitatea acesteia
 Designer – se ocupa de design-ul interfetei, propune aspectul final al interfetei in functie de
cerintele beneficiarului
 Tester – testeaza aplicatia
 Trainer – dezvolta planul de instruire, instrueste viitorii utilizatori
 Tehnoredactor – creeaza manualele de instalare si utilizare, precum si documentele rezultate din
analiza problemei.

III. Execuţia activităţilor

5
1. Estimarea efortului pe fiecare activitate
Pentru a fi mai usor de dezvoltat ,acest proiect, a fost impartit in activitati, iar fiecare
activitate cuprinde subactivitati. Acestea ofera o imagine mai clara a modului in care evolueaza
proiectul si pot fi realizate intrun interval de timp mai scurt.
În functie de complexitatea fiecarei activitati si de efortul depus pentru a o putea finaliza cu
success, acestora, leau fost alocate un numar de zile, precum si responsabilii care au obligatia de a
realiza respectiva activitate.

Nume Activitate Durata Executant


Discutia cu beneficiarul 5 zile Managerul de proiect
Analiza problemei 3 zile Analist,tehnoredactor
Proiectarea bazei de date 3 zile Proiectant baze de date
Realizarea bazei de date 3 zile Proiectant baza de date
Proiectarea site-ului web 5 zile Designer, Analist
Implementare 19 zile Programator junior, Programator senior
Testarea bazei de date şi asite-ului web 8 zile Tester
Instruirea utilizatorilor 5 zile Trainer
Mentenanta 6 zile Programator senior, Manager de proiect
TOTAL 57 zile

2. Calendarul de execuţie
Fiecărei activităţi I s-au alocat un număr de zile permiţând astfel monitorizarea mai eficientă
a evoluţiei aplicaţiei care urmează a fi dezvoltată. Aceste activităţi au o data precisă când trebuie să
înceapă şi când trebuie să fie finalizate, din acest motiv, suntem nevoiţi să respectăm calendarul de
execuţie, deoarece, nerespectarea lui va decala toate activităţile următoare, implicit şi termenul de
livrare al produsului.

Nume Activitate Durata Început Sfârşit


Discutia cu beneficiarul 5 zile 02.03.2015 06.03.2015
Analiza problemei 3 zile 09.03.2015 11.03.2015
Proiectarea bazei de date 3 zile 12.03.2015 16.03.2015
Realizarea bazei de date 3 zile 17.03.2015 19.03.2015
Proiectarea site-ului web 5 zile 20.03.2015 26.03.2015
Implementare 19 zile 27.03.2015 22.04.2015
Testarea bazei de date şi 8 zile 23.04.2015 05.05.2015
asite-ului web
Instruirea utilizatorilor 5 zile 06.05.2015 12.05.2015
Mentenanta 6 zile 13.05.2015 20.05.2015
TOTAL 57 zile 02.03.2015 20.05.2015

IV. Managementul comunicării cu clientul

6
 Pentru o comunicare bună, trebuie să se poarte discuții sau să se facă întâlniri cu clientul o dată
pe săptămână. Această comunicare cu beneficiarul trebuie să se desfașoare pe toată perioada
realizării proiectului.
 Comunicarea cu clientul este necesară pentru a evita eventualele neînțelegeri, dar și pentru a
putea lua anumite decizii necesare efectuării anumitor task-uri. Beneficiarul trebuie să fie
multumit la final, și pentru asta sunt folosite anumite resurse umane pentru a face schimb de
informații.
 Clientul va discuta prima dată cu managerul de proiect pentru a afla ce fel de proiect îi este
necesar acestuia, care sunt cerințele și așteptările. Trainerul va fi cel care va fi trimis periodic la
beneficiar pentru a primi confirmări despre proiect în stadiul respectiv.
 În momentul deciziei asupra interfeței grafice, designer-ul va face schița cu aspectul grafic al
interfeței și i-o va comunica clientului prin trainer.
 Spre finalul proiectului trainerul se va ocupa de instalarea produsului obținut, dar și de instruirea
personalului ce va folosi rezultatul proiectului.
 Pentru mentenață testerul va colabora cu beneficiarul în momentul în care va fi nevoie.

V. Managementul riscurilor
Un plan de management al riscurilor proiectului este un document de control, care
incorporeaza scopurile si metodele pentru gestionarea riscurilor unui proiect. Planul de management
al riscurilor descrie toate aspectele pentru identificarea riscului, estimarea, evaluarea si procesul de
controlare al acestuia.

1. Identificarea riscurilor:
 Insuficienţa resurselor disponibile pentru terminarea proiectului
 Insuficienţa timpului aprobat pentru terminarea proiectului
 Neclaritatea aşteptărilor/anticipărilor proiectului, care duce la obţinerea de rezultate incomplete
sau nepotrivite
 Neînţelegeri între deţinătorii de interese (stakeholders) privind aşteptările/anticipările
proiectului, care conduc la insatisfacţii referitor rezultatului proiectului
 Posibilitatea ca unul dintre angajaţi, implicat în proiect (programator, proiectant, tester, etc) să
devină incapabil în aşi desfaşura activitatea planificată
 Defecţiuni tehnice
 Îmbolnăviri de personal

VI. Managementul resurselor


Salariile angajaţilor care au participat direct la realizarea acestui proiect au fost stabilite în
urma estimării efortului depus, a rezultatelor obţinute în urma efortului şi a experienţei profesionale
acumulate de fiecare dintre ei.

Functie Salariu/ora Ore lucrate Salariu total


Manager de proiect 35 lei 56 1960 lei
Analist 10 lei 24 240 lei
Proiectant baze de date 20 lei 64 1280 lei
Programator junior x 2 18 lei 32 576 lei
Programator senior x 2 28 lei 160 4480 lei
Designer 20 lei 40 800 lei
Tehnoredactor 10 lei 8 80 lei
Tester 15 lei 64 960 lei

7
Trainer 15 lei 40 600 lei
SUBTOTAL 10976 lei
ALTE CHELTUIELI 3000 lei
PROFIT 11024 lei
TOTAL 25000 lei

VII. Managementul activităţilor


1. Activităţile necesare dezvoltării proiectului
1.1. Discuţia cu beneficiarul (6 zile)
 Determinare obiective proiect (2 zile)
 Determinare rescuri proiect (1 zi)
 Prezentarea ofertei în funcţie de cerinţele clientului (1 zi)
 Negocierea contractului (1 zi)
 Semnarea contractului (1 zi)

1.2. Analiza problemei (3 zile)


 Identificare soluţii posibilie (1 zi)
 Selectare soluţii optime (1 zi)
 Relatarea şi tehnoredactarea documentelor studiate (1 zi)

1.3. Proiectarea bazei de date (4 zile)


 Proiectarea la nivel conceptual (1 zi)
 Proiectarea la nivel logic (1 zi)
 Realizarea schemei fizice a bazei de date (2 zile)

1.4. Realizarea bazei de date (4 zile)


 Creearea tabelelor şi legăturilor dintre ele (2 zile)
 Aplicarea restricţiilor pentru fiecare tabelă (2 zile)

1.5. Proiectarea site-ului web (6 zile)


 Propunerea interfeţei (1 zi)
 Proiectarea interfeţei (4 zile)
 Decizia aspectului final (1 zi)

1.6. Implementare (19 zile)


 Conexiunea site-ului web cu baza de date (2 zile)
 Introducerea datelor în baza de date (4 zile)
 Restricţii la introducerea datelor în baza de date (3 zile)
 Preluarea datelor din baza de date şi afişarea lor pe site (5 zile)
 Sortarea datelor în funcţie de criteriile dorite (5 zile)

1.7. Testarea bazei de date şi a site-ului web (8 zile)


 Testarea introducerii datelor în baza de date (2 zile)
 Testarea modificării datelor (2 zile)
 Sortarea datelor (1 zi şi 4 ore)
 Testarea funcţionalităţii site-ului web (1 zi şi 4 ore)
 Realizarea rapoartelor (1 zi)
1.8. Instruirea personalului (5 zile)
 Plan de instruire (1 zi)

8
 Instruirea personalului (4 zile)

1.9. Mentenanţă (6 zile)


 Plan de mentenanţă (2 zile)
 Material pentru asigurarea mentenanţei (3 zile)
 Alegerea personalului pentru asigurarea mentenanţei (1 zi)

VIII. Managementul calităţii


Managementul calitatii cuprinde trei functii:
 Planificare - acest proces urmareste dezvoltarea de produse si procese care sa corespunda
cerintelor clientilor. Planificarea calitatii cuprinde activitatile prin care se stabilesc obiectivele si
cerintele privind calitatea software, precum si resursele umane, financiare si mateiale necesare
realizarii obiectivelor.
 Asigurarea calitatii cuprinde activitatile preventive prin care se urmareste, in mod sistematic,
corectitudinea si eficienta activitatilor de planificare si control, pentru a garanta obtinerea unor
produse software care sa satisfaca cerintele de calitate asteptate de clienti.
 Imbunatatirea calitatii cuprinde activitatile desfasurate in fiecare etapa a ciclului de viata al unui
sistem de programe, in scopul obtinerii unui nivel calitativ superior celui planificat, in conditiile
desfasurarii corespunzatoare a activitatilor de planificare, control si asigurare a calitatii.
Inbunatatirea fiabilitatii, ca urmare a asigurarii calitatii, se face prin verificarea si validarea
sistemelor de programe.

IX. Încheierea proiectului


In aceasta etapa finala, managerul de proiect desfasoara urmatoarele activitati:
 Isi da acceptul pentru rezultatul final;
 Face si trimite rapoarte finale;
 Informeaza partenerii despre proiect si rezultatele finale;
 Felicita echipa pentru munca depusa si da noi responsabilitati pentru fiecare membru;
 Evalueaza proiectul pentru uz intern;
 Subliniaza performanta si rezultatele;
 Subliniaza orice defectiune sau obiective neatinse.

Evaluarea si sublinierea performantelor dar si a slabiciunilor ar trebuie sa fie facute cat mai
riguros posibil: sa propuna unele intalniri, seminarii, spatii de lucru si crearea unor documente in
acest sens.
In acest punct, proiectul se incheie cu success, am obtinut acceptul clientului, satisfacandu-i
astepataile si dorintele. Clientul va primi mentenanta din partea firmei mentinandu-se si o
colaborare.

9
Bibliografie
Luminita Dumitriu – Suport de curs la disciplina Managementul Proiectelor Informatice

10

S-ar putea să vă placă și